Hi I am preparing my fronts and I need some help for one of them.
Our apocalypse is a eternal winter vomiting ashes and snow storms.
The characters:
- A hocus who want to lead her people south.
- A gunlugger who think his lost son went south.
- A brainer intrigued by the hocus who want to go south.
The group is trying to go south to run away from the winter and cannibals.
For now I have the home front, the men hunters (cannibals) front and a winter front.
The prep of the home front and the men hunters front went well, but I am hesitating a little with my winter front since this is not a group of people.
So for now I have (I have put in bold my main hesitations):
Front: Winter
Express: despair
Dark future/agenda: cover the entire world?
Description & cast: ash snow, storms, freezing cold ?
Stakes questions:
- do summer still exist in the south?
- can people survive the winter?
Threat 1: The road south
Kind: landscape/mirage
Impulse: entice & betray people
Cast: people migrating south, ?
Custom move: ?
Countdown: this is where I am hesitating. For now I have the idea that more and more people will migrate south. But should I focus on the actual "road" or the trip?
Threat 2: The freezing cold
Kind: affliction/condition
Impulse: expose people to danger
Cast: ?
Custom move: something about freezing?
Countdown: I am aslo hesitating here. The temperature could become colder and colder. Or maybe a super ash-snow storm could happen. Maybe something weird could lurk in the cold. Or maybe I should focus on the effects on the general population?
